In the decades since the Great Society, service sectors as diverse as public assistance, Medicaid, long-term care, and mental health have come to rely on case management to coordinate and rationalize service delivery. Created as a tool for integrating services on the level of the individual client, case management has evolved into a means of rationing resources and controlling costs. Thus a program that began as a service technique has helped to drive the most significant trends in American health care and social welfare, including the entrenchment of bureaucracy, the challenging of once dominant professions, and the rise of corporate control.
